Green Wesley “Buddy” Norman, 83, of Sale City died Friday, February 25, 2022 at his residence in Sale City.  Funeral services will be 11:00 a.m. Monday, February 28 at Sale City Baptist Church with interment in Sale City Cemetery.  Rev. Tim Bozeman will officiate.

Born June 4, 1938 in Rose Hill, GA, Mr. Norman was the son of the late Raymond Dozier Norman and Alma Maldys Taylor Norman.  He was preceded in death by his sister, Nita Norman.  Mr. Norman was retired from the United States Army, after 20 years of service.  He was a farmer and a member of Pebble City Baptist Church.
